// src/index.ts
import { produce } from "immer";
import { compare } from "fast-json-patch";
var createStore = (config) => {
let currentState = config.initialState;
const stateListeners = /* @__PURE__ */ new Set();
const eventListeners = /* @__PURE__ */ new Map();
let storeInstance;
const notifyStateListeners = () => {
stateListeners.forEach((listener) => listener(currentState));
};
const notifyEventListeners = (eventType, event) => {
const listeners = eventListeners.get(eventType);
if (listeners) {
listeners.forEach((listener) => {
try {
const result = listener(event, storeInstance);
if (result instanceof Promise) {
result.catch((error) => {
console.error(`[Native Store] Unhandled promise rejection in async event listener for type "${eventType}":`, error);
});
}
} catch (error) {
console.error(`[Native Store] Error in event listener for type "${eventType}":`, error);
}
});
}
};
storeInstance = {
getSnapshot: () => currentState,
dispatch: (event) => {
let stateChanged = false;
if (config.producer) {
const nextState = produce(currentState, (draft) => {
config.producer(draft, event);
});
if (nextState !== currentState) {
currentState = nextState;
stateChanged = true;
}
}
if (stateChanged) {
notifyStateListeners();
}
notifyEventListeners(event.type, event);
},
subscribe: (listener) => {
stateListeners.add(listener);
listener(currentState);
return () => {
stateListeners.delete(listener);
};
},
on: (eventType, listener) => {
const eventTypeStr = eventType;
if (!eventListeners.has(eventTypeStr)) {
eventListeners.set(eventTypeStr, /* @__PURE__ */ new Set());
}
const listeners = eventListeners.get(eventTypeStr);
const typedListener = listener;
listeners.add(typedListener);
return () => {
listeners.delete(typedListener);
if (listeners.size === 0) {
eventListeners.delete(eventTypeStr);
}
};
},
reset: () => {
currentState = config.initialState;
notifyStateListeners();
}
};
if (config.on) {
for (const eventType in config.on) {
if (Object.prototype.hasOwnProperty.call(config.on, eventType)) {
const listener = config.on[eventType];
if (listener) {
storeInstance.on(eventType, listener);
}
}
}
}
return storeInstance;
};
function createNativeBridge() {
const stores = /* @__PURE__ */ new Map();
const webViews = /* @__PURE__ */ new Set();
const readyWebViews = /* @__PURE__ */ new Set();
const readyStateListeners = /* @__PURE__ */ new Map();
const storeListeners = /* @__PURE__ */ new Set();
const notifyStoreListeners = () => {
storeListeners.forEach((listener) => listener());
};
const notifyReadyStateListeners = (webView, isReady) => {
const listeners = readyStateListeners.get(webView);
if (listeners) {
listeners.forEach((listener) => listener(isReady));
}
};
const broadcastToWebViews = (message) => {
const messageString = JSON.stringify(message);
webViews.forEach((webView) => {
if (webView.postMessage) {
webView.postMessage(messageString);
} else {
console.warn("[Native Bridge] WebView instance lacks postMessage method.");
}
});
};
const processWebViewMessage = (data, sourceWebView) => {
let parsedData;
try {
parsedData = JSON.parse(data);
} catch (e) {
console.warn("[Native Bridge] Failed to parse message:", data, e);
return;
}
if (!parsedData || typeof parsedData !== "object" || !("type" in parsedData)) {
console.warn("[Native Bridge] Invalid message format:", parsedData);
return;
}
switch (parsedData.type) {
case "BRIDGE_READY": {
const targetWebViews = sourceWebView ? [sourceWebView] : Array.from(webViews);
targetWebViews.forEach((webView) => {
if (!webView)
return;
readyWebViews.add(webView);
notifyReadyStateListeners(webView, true);
stores.forEach((store, key) => {
const initMessage = JSON.stringify({
type: "STATE_INIT",
storeKey: key,
data: store.getSnapshot()
});
if (webView.postMessage)
webView.postMessage(initMessage);
});
});
break;
}
case "EVENT": {
const { storeKey, event } = parsedData;
const store = stores.get(storeKey);
if (store) {
store.dispatch(event);
}
break;
}
}
};
return {
isSupported: () => true,
getStore: (key) => {
return stores.get(key);
},
setStore: (key, store) => {
if (store === void 0) {
stores.delete(key);
} else {
let prevState = store.getSnapshot();
stores.set(key, store);
const initMessage = {
type: "STATE_INIT",
storeKey: key,
data: store.getSnapshot()
};
broadcastToWebViews(initMessage);
store.subscribe((currentState) => {
const operations = compare(prevState, currentState);
if (operations.length > 0) {
broadcastToWebViews({
type: "STATE_UPDATE",
storeKey: key,
operations
});
}
prevState = currentState;
});
}
notifyStoreListeners();
},
subscribe: (listener) => {
storeListeners.add(listener);
return () => {
storeListeners.delete(listener);
};
},
handleWebMessage: (message) => {
const messageData = typeof message === "string" ? message : message.nativeEvent.data;
processWebViewMessage(messageData, void 0);
},
registerWebView: (webView) => {
if (!webView)
return () => {
};
webViews.add(webView);
stores.forEach((store, key) => {
const initMessage = JSON.stringify({
type: "STATE_INIT",
storeKey: key,
data: store.getSnapshot()
});
if (webView.postMessage)
webView.postMessage(initMessage);
});
return () => {
webViews.delete(webView);
readyWebViews.delete(webView);
readyStateListeners.delete(webView);
};
},
unregisterWebView: (webView) => {
if (!webView)
return;
webViews.delete(webView);
readyWebViews.delete(webView);
readyStateListeners.delete(webView);
},
subscribeToReadyState: (webView, callback) => {
if (!webView) {
callback(false);
return () => {
};
}
let listeners = readyStateListeners.get(webView);
if (!listeners) {
listeners = /* @__PURE__ */ new Set();
readyStateListeners.set(webView, listeners);
}
listeners.add(callback);
callback(readyWebViews.has(webView));
return () => {
const currentListeners = readyStateListeners.get(webView);
if (currentListeners) {
currentListeners.delete(callback);
if (currentListeners.size === 0) {
readyStateListeners.delete(webView);
}
}
};
},
getReadyState: (webView) => {
if (!webView)
return false;
return readyWebViews.has(webView);
}
};
}
export {
createNativeBridge,
createStore
};
